    A recent discovery of an Ediacaran-era fossil (circa 560 mya) in the UK at the famous Charnwood Forest in the Midlands of England has been named after the legendary Sir David Attenborough and is believed by invertebrate palaeontologists to be the earliest known marine predator that used its morphoogy to capture smaller prey.
